I’m all for hiring an SEO consultant over an agency, but if I had to choose, I’d go with an agency; and the reason is – they’ll have more hands-on experience. Consultants are great, and they’re very knowledgeable, but they may be limited in experience. Agencies will have a team of people with different skills and they’ll also utilize various technologies to get your website to rank. The only drawback is that agencies are more expensive and usually have monthly retainers. But if you have the budget, then I’d go with an agency.
Small companies must consider both alternatives' scale and scope of services to make the best decision to optimize their web presence. By partnering with an SEO consultant, we could access tailored services that addressed our unique needs, engage in a one-on-one relationship, and focus on enhancing specific aspects of our website's SEO. This personalized approach addressed our urgent requirements and proved to be more cost-effective than enlisting the help of larger SEO agencies that tend to deliver a broader range of services to an extensive clientele. Ultimately, our choice to hire a consultancy enabled us to obtain the bespoke SEO solutions necessary for the growth and success of our small business.
The main difference between an SEO consultant and an SEO agency is the scope of services they provide. An SEO consultant typically works on a single project or provides a limited number of services, whereas an SEO agency offers a broader range of services and can provide ongoing support. For an SMB, the best option is to hire an SEO agency, as they are able to provide comprehensive support and ensure that the best strategies are implemented.
I would say that a core difference between a consultant and an agency is the direct level of a working relationship that you can have with a consultant. Whilst agencies can also be great to work with, it's hard to have this same type of relationship due to team sizes and many more moving pieces, purely down to the nature of how an agency runs. An SMB looking to have that direct relationship when it comes to their SEO strategy would be much better suited to a consultant over an agency in this regard.
As someone who has utilized both SEO Consultants and Agencies, I can confidently say that Consultants are the better option for smaller businesses looking to make an investment in their website’s search engine rankings. Consultants tend to be experts in a niche area of SEO, so they offer more personalized services than larger Agencies. Additionally, Consultants typically cost much less than Agencies as they are generally sole proprietors or small shops without overhead costs associated with larger firms. Consultants may also become more like a business partner such as when they champion specific projects or monitor progress while providing valuable feedback during longer engagement periods that last beyond the delivery of services. The personalize service provided by Consultants, along with their affordability, makes them an excellent choice for any small business looking to optimize its search engine visibility.
SEO consultants are collaborators in your business. They answer questions, provide guidance, and manage projects and teams on your behalf. Agencies are outsourced partners that do the work for you. As an SMB, deciding which one to hire depends on the existing skills and knowledge within your business. If you're stuck on a problem but otherwise have the talent to implement a solution, a consultant is your best bet. If you need extra hands because you lack specialized knowledge, agencies are the way forward.
An SEO consultant typically provides services on their own, whereas agencies employ multiple employees with different areas of expertise. A solo SEO consultant may not have as many resources availaable to them in terms of technology or personnel compared to larger firms but they often work faster due to fewer decision-makers necessary for approval processes. Plus, when working with individual consultants you can tailor your engagement more easily than if it was part of a large team under one roof - this makes the process much smoother and less time-consuming. When deciding which option works best for an SMB it really depends upon what type of service they are looking for: If they require quick turnaround times then hiring an independent would be ideal, however, if there's some complexity involved such as needing both multiple and asynchronous work then enlisting the support from broader marketing firm would most likely give better results overall given its larger bandwidth.
SEO consultants and agencies have different skill sets and do different jobs. A consultant can give you the data to make an informed decision about whether your site needs an update, but they don´t use it to put the right changes into place. Therefore, you must understand that SEO consultants will analyze your goals, your resources, and what you have done until now, and then they will provide you with a roadmap to success. On the other hand, an SEO agency can help you implement the changes and to execute your SEO strategy. They use to be more hands-on and provide the implementation. In my opinion, if the SMB has a limited budget and has a specific goal, the best option to hire is an SEO consultant.
An SEO consultant is a highly skilled individual while an SEO agency contains many SEOs or a team of SEO. Search Engine Optimization consultant is highly skilled and has many years of experience in the same field. He works with the goal of improving the websites of businesses and brands. If you want to work with an SEO consultant, check the success record of that SEO. He should be able to show you the evidence of past projects that were successful in improving the website’s rank. If you want a more personalized approach for your website, then an SEO consultant would be the best choice. Whereas, the agency has a team of experts. They are responsible for different areas of SEO like the On-Page SEO team, Off-Page SEO team, Local SEO team, technical SEO team, and Content marketing team. An SEO consultant would be the best choice for a small business to rank its website. A good SEO consultant can do link-building and on-site optimization as per your business needs.
One key difference between SEO consultants and agencies is the scope of their services. SEO consultants typically work independently and focus on providing strategic advice, technical optimizations, and content recommendations to improve a website's search engine visibility. On the other hand, SEO agencies offer a broader range of services, including not only SEO but also digital marketing, web design, and development. For SMBs, hiring an SEO consultant may be a better option if they have a limited budget and want to focus specifically on improving their search engine rankings. A consultant can provide personalized attention and expertise to help the SMB achieve its SEO goals. However, if an SMB has a larger budget and needs a more comprehensive digital marketing strategy, an SEO agency might be a better option as it can provide a wider range of services to meet their needs. Ultimately, the decision should be based on the specific needs and goals of the SMB.
SEO consultants guide you as you work through your website's SEO practices and give you practical advice that ensures you can get the work done by yourself. On the other hand, SEO agencies take over the SEO tasks on your behalf hence do it and deliver the results to you over an agreed period. For SMBs, I recommend working with a consultant over agencies as it helps with the learning curve, ensuring that you are self-reliant in this field long after the engagement is over.
If you're an SMB looking to hire an SEO professional, one key difference between consultants and agencies is their scalability. SEO consultants are typically individual practitioners who can provide personalized attention and can adapt to your specific needs. In contrast, SEO agencies are larger, have more resources, and can handle bigger projects, but may have less flexibility in catering to individual clients. For smaller businesses with a limited budget, hiring an SEO consultant could be the best option as they are generally less expensive and can work closely with your business to achieve targeted goals. However, if your business is larger or has more complex needs, an SEO agency's greater scalability, access to advanced tools, and larger team can provide more comprehensive and effective solutions. Ultimately, the best choice for your SMB depends on your specific goals, budget, and business size.
Overall, agencies are more likely to deliver quality SEO results for an SMB, as they offer a wider scope of services. In addition to SEO, for example, they can revamp a slow website, create blog content, build backlinks, and more. This is more helpful for SMBs that are more medium than small and have multiple locations. SEO consultants, on the other hand, are a better fit for smaller businesses who don't really need a comprehensive SEO solution.
An SEO consultant is a single, highly-trained expert, whereas an SEO agency is a group of such people. With a consultant, you’ll have a very personalized, one-to-one service. An agency will have more eyes on your SEO plans. There’s no one best choice for an SMB to hire, rather it’s a matter of comfortability and choice. Would you feel better with one set of eyes or two or more? Both choices will help boost your SEO, but it’s up to you how they’ll do it as an individual or a team.
Successful SEO campaigns and even regular SEO maintenance require a team that is well-versed in the basics and is also updated on the latest in optimization. This means that a team is not only responsible for their regular SEO duties but also required to commit to learning and development. After all, being in sync with the latest evolutions so they can deliver updates helps a team stay in the race. If your team isn’t committed to these developments or if you’re unable to line up these learning resources for them, hiring an agency is always a more efficient bet. An agency ensures that its teams are always at the top of their game and know what’s happening around them. This means that you always get the latest in SEO services and regularly receive the benefits associated with important updates too.
As an SEO independent consultant, I believe that working with a consultant can often provide SMBs with a more specialized service at a lower cost. Furthermore, having specialized knowledge in a particular industry can be a game-changer when developing SEO strategies. For instance, my expertise in Web3 has given me an advantage in creating successful SEO solutions for leading players in this industry. I even won a pitch against the largest UK SEO agency as a one-woman band specializing in Web3 SEO. This focused expertise can deliver measurable results that businesses in niche industries, such as blockchain, require. Additionally, consultants act as an integral part of the team, providing a consistent and personal touch that clients value. In contrast to the revolving door of agency personnel, a dedicated consultant can establish a robust working relationship, leading to better collaboration and, ultimately, better results.
If you do not have the resources to run your SEO, there’s no point in hiring a consultant. In such a scenario, hiring an agency to do all your SEO work for you makes more sense. On the other hand, if you have the entire lineup of resources at your disposal already (or the potential to invest and set it up), you need a consultant to put everything together and show your team how to run the show. A consultant can only offer you ideas and direction when your company already has a team and the required tools and resources in place. Without these elements in place, even the most insightful inputs from a consultant would have nowhere to go.
An SEO consultant works for his/her own self whereas an SEO agency has a lot of specialists and talented people in different SEO areas. When choosing between the two, look for your company goals and also note down what kind of strategies would you look forward to for your company. An SEO consultant can offer more personalised or bespoke packages suited to your needs. On the other hand, the benefit of working with an agency is when you are looking for services in addition to SEO like PPC or social media. Start looking for an SEO consultant or an SEO agency keeping in mind your budget for the same. For doing this, one must have an idea about their work so that one can keep a check on them. Decision making is always going to be difficult but we need to weight out pros and cons of both. If my focus area is to improve organic visibility, I will probably go for SEO consultants as they can offer more custom approach and they are more reachable too.
In house has a vested interest in strengthening and improving your business so that it grows over time. Quick and fast work is fine for an agency, and the expertise is definitely there, but in-house SEO's are really underrated. They know your product, they know your culture, they know your voice. It's hard to carry that over to a paid agency.
SEO consultants are typically individual professionals specializing in search engine optimization and providing clients with a range of SEO services. They often work independently or as part of a small team and may have expertise in a particular industry or niche. On the other hand, SEO agencies are larger organizations that provide a wider range of digital marketing services, including SEO, social media, content marketing, and more. They often have larger teams of experts with diverse skill sets and may work with a broader range of clients across multiple industries. The best option for an SMB looking to hire an SEO professional depends on their specific needs and budget. Working with an individual consultant may be a more cost-effective option if the business has a smaller website and only requires basic SEO services. However, if the business has a larger website and requires a more comprehensive digital marketing strategy, working with an agency may provide more value and expertise.